Lunar New Year event features more red Pokémon appearing in the wild, lucky bonuses and the first appearance of Darumaka in Pokémon GO

Following a series of teases from Niantic, the Year of the Rat event has officially been announced for Pokémon GO to celebrate the Lunar New Year. Read on below for more details:

Pokémon GO Lunar New Year Event

Date + Time

Friday, January 24, 2020, at 1:00 p.m. to Monday, February 3, 2020, at 1:00 p.m. PST (GMT −8)

Features

  • Certain red Pokémon will be featured. Charmeleon, Vulpix, Parasect, Voltorb, Jynx, Magmar, Magikarp, Flareon, Slugma, Wurmple, Corphish, Kricketot, and Foongus will appear more frequently in the wild!
  • Gyashaa! If you’re lucky, you might spot a Gyarados in the wild. Will you be lucky enough to encounter the coveted red Shiny Gyarados?
  • Darumaka will hatch from 7 km Eggs. Some red Pokémon will be hatching from 7 km Eggs, such as Shuckle and Foongus. Making their Pokémon GO debuts will be Darumaka and Darmanitan, the Zen Charm Pokémon!

Bonuses

  • Gifts will have a chance of rewarding you with Rare Candies, so be sure to send and open lots of Gifts with your friends.
  • Be sure to trade more often with your friends—the likelihood of becoming Lucky Friends will be increased.
  • When you trade a Pokémon, there will be an increased chance it will become a Lucky Pokémon.

Minccino Limited Research

In celebration of the Year of the Rat, Minccino, the Chinchilla Pokémon, will be appearing in Pokémon GO for a special Limited Research event. Professor Willow has also uncovered that Minccino can evolve into Cinccino through use of a Unova Stone!

Date + Time

Sunday, February 2, 2020, from 2:00 p.m. to 5:00 p.m. local time

Features

  • Field Research: Minccino Limited Research tasks will allow you to encounter Minccino.
  • Pokémon that fit the theme of the Year of the Rat will be appearing more frequently in the wild. Look out for Rattata, Raticate, Pikachu, Sandshrew, Nidoran♀, Nidoran♂, Sentret, Marill, Zigzagoon, Plusle, Minun, Bidoof, and Patrat.
  • Minccino in 5 km Eggs: Minccino will be hatching more frequently from 5 km Eggs. After the event ends, Minccino will continue to be available in 5 km Eggs.
  • Shiny Minccino and Shiny Cinccino will be available! If you’re lucky, you might encounter them!
